Default Buying new tires.

Went into discount tire to buy Hancook ventus v12tires. I have old z06 18" all around. The salesman ask me what size of tires I wanted. I was stumped. He suggested 245/40 ,9.5 " wide on the front . 285/35 11.25"on the back. Is this a good size? As he suggested there are different sizes available . And widths.

For a frame of reference I am running the same tires with 275/35/18's on a 9.5 in. front wheel and 305/30/19's on an 11 in. rear.

I have 265-35-18 on a 9.5 rim in the front and 295-35-18 on a 10.5 rim in the rear with ZO6 rims on my C-5 vert. Goodyear tires
